    Gammon in British English is the hind leg of pork after it has been cured by dry-salting or brining, [1] and may or may not be smoked. [2] Strictly speaking, a gammon is the bottom end of a whole side of bacon (which includes the back leg); ham is just the back leg cured on its own. [ 3 ]

    The bacterial cell wall differs from that of all other organisms by the presence of peptidoglycan which is located immediately outside of the cell membrane. Peptidoglycan is made up of a polysaccharide backbone consisting of alternating N-Acetylmuramic acid (NAM) and N-acetylglucosamine (NAG) residues in equal amounts.

    The cell wall of bacteria is also distinct from that of achaea, which do not contain peptidoglycan. The cell wall is essential to the survival of many bacteria, and the antibiotic penicillin (produced by a fungus called Penicillium) is able to kill bacteria by inhibiting a step in the synthesis of peptidoglycan.     The name comes from the Danish bacteriologist Hans Christian Gram, who developed the technique in 1884. [2] Gram staining differentiates bacteria by the chemical and physical properties of their cell walls. Gram-positive cells have a thick layer of peptidoglycan in the cell wall that retains the primary stain, crystal violet.
